Output 73cdb6383c183615016a5be29f2bb9e8d37751f197a9ad532c60785c6e0949be:4

value
56990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081ce341076e83bbf860ccc564ab3b2b5ce90adc OP_EQUAL
address
32RuwEPr82MEf4UpKQTqwsoini2yJRufwU
transaction
73cdb6383c183615016a5be29f2bb9e8d37751f197a9ad532c60785c6e0949be
spent
true